Technical Field
The utility model relates to the technical field of optical cable protection, in particular to an optical cable protection device.
Background
Optical fiber cables (optical fiber cables) are manufactured to meet optical, mechanical, or environmental performance specifications using one or more optical fibers disposed in a covering sheath as a transmission medium and may be used alone or in groups of communication cable assemblies. The optical cable mainly consists of optical fibers (glass filaments like hair) and plastic protective sleeves and plastic sheaths. In the process of connecting and installing the optical cables, the optical cables are required to be installed by using the fixing equipment, the fixing equipment also plays a role in protection when indoor, after the optical cables are fixed, the optical cables can be ensured not to be damaged due to weight when in use, and the optical cables are connected more firmly after being fixed, so that the fixing equipment can also be called as protection equipment; in the existing protective equipment for fixing the optical cable, the optical cable is simply installed and fixed by using a clamping sleeve type structure, and for the multi-strand connected optical cable, the optical cable connection part is easy to loosen due to artificial intentional or unintentional pulling.

The utility model aims to overcome the defects of the prior art, provides the optical cable protection device which is reasonable in structure, can stably clamp the optical cable, avoids loosening of the connecting part of the optical cable caused by pulling, is suitable for optical cables with different specifications, and is convenient to use.
In order to solve the technical problem, the optical cable protection device comprises a left fixed cover and a right fixed cover, wherein fixing grooves are formed in the left fixed cover and the right fixed cover, screws are arranged on the left fixed cover and the right fixed cover, the screws penetrate and extend into the fixing grooves, rotating pieces are arranged at the upper ends of the screws in a connecting mode, rotating sleeves are arranged at the lower ends of the screws in a matching mode, moving plates are arranged at the lower ends of the rotating sleeves in a connecting mode, the moving plates are arranged in the fixing grooves in a matching mode, a plurality of clamping devices are arranged below the moving plates, through holes are formed in the left fixed cover and the right fixed cover, a plurality of clamping devices are arranged on the inner walls of the through holes, a first fixing sleeve is connected to one side of the left fixed cover, a locking device is arranged at one end of the first fixing sleeve in a connecting mode, a second fixing sleeve is arranged on one side of the right fixed cover, a clamping groove is arranged in the second fixing sleeve in a matching mode, and an optical cable extends out of the through hole in the second fixing sleeve in a matching mode.
Further, the clamping device comprises a clamping piece and a first spring, wherein the clamping piece is made of rubber, and the distance between every two adjacent clamping devices is equal.
Further, the locking device comprises a fixed rod, the upper end of the fixed rod is hinged with a rotating rod, one end of the rotating rod is connected with a pressing rod, the other end of the rotating rod is connected with a locking rod, and a second spring is connected between the pressing rod and the first fixed sleeve.
Further, the moving plate and the clamping piece are arc-shaped.
Further, the locking rod is matched and arranged in the clamping groove.
Further, the left fixed cover and the right fixed cover are connected with each other at two sides of the lower end of the left fixed cover and the right fixed cover, and screw holes are formed in the fixed edges.
Compared with the prior art, the utility model has the advantages that: the device is provided with the clamping device, the screw rod and the moving plate, can be matched to clamp, fix and protect the optical cable, can be matched with the optical cables with different diameters, and is convenient and quick to use; the clamping device can lock the left fixed cover and the right fixed cover during installation, so that the looseness of the connecting part of the optical cable caused by the looseness of the left fixed cover and the right fixed cover is avoided; the first fixed sleeve and the second fixed sleeve of the device can effectively protect the connecting part of the optical cable.

The clamping device comprises a clamping piece 15 and a first spring 16, the clamping piece 15 is made of rubber, the optical cable 20 can be ensured to be clamped, meanwhile, the optical cable 20 is prevented from being crushed by the hard material, the distance between every two adjacent clamping devices is equal, and the moving plate 12 and the clamping piece 15 are arc-shaped, so that the optical cable 20 can be clamped conveniently.
The locking device comprises a fixed rod 7, the upper end of the fixed rod 7 is hinged with a rotating rod 6, one end of the rotating rod 6 is connected with a pressing rod 8, the other end of the rotating rod 6 is connected with a locking rod 10, a spring II 9 is connected between the pressing rod 8 and a fixed sleeve I17, and the clamping device can be changed into a loosening state by pressing the pressing rod 8, so that the operation is convenient.
In the concrete implementation of the utility model, the left fixed cover and the right fixed cover are sleeved at the joint of the optical cables, the pressing rod is pressed downwards as shown in fig. 1 according to the size of the joint of the optical cables, the pressing rod drives the rotating rod to rotate anticlockwise, the fixed rod is moved out of the clamping groove, the right fixed cover is pulled, the pressing rod is loosened, the fixed rod is matched with the clamping groove again, the rotating pieces on the left fixed cover and the right fixed cover are rotated, the rotating pieces drive the screw to rotate, the screw pushes the moving plate to move downwards, so that the optical cables are clamped by the clamping device, and finally the device is fixed on the wall through the screw.
